Behavioral changes

Behavioral changes can have a major impact on the process of saving energy if practiced correctly and consistently. Just the act of switching off the lights in your home and switching off appliances when they are not being used can make a huge difference in how much energy you save during the course of the day.

Energy saving appliances

Whenever you visit a shop to buy an appliance, always make sure to go for the ones with the energy saving option so that you can avoid paying a hefty bill at the end of the month and also contribute positively to the wellbeing of the environment.

Nowadays, almost all appliances that we use on a day to day basis come with models that are energy saving so instead of opting for the regular appliances, always opt for a model that have energy saving mechanisms even if the price is higher because what little extra you pay for the energy saving appliance, you can easily save from your utility bills.

Cut down on water heating

Water heating is one of the major factors that contribute to your total energy consumption so unless you are planning to invest in an energy efficient water heater, there are a few things that you could do to reduce your energy consumption.

Some of the few things that you could do are, use less hot water, and put the thermostat on your water heater on low and insulating the cold and hot water pipes could also help retain the temperature of the water.
